The cheapest way to get from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station is to drive which costs $9 - $14 and takes 1h 3m.
The fastest way to get from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station is to drive which takes 1h 3m and costs $9 - $14.
No, there is no direct train from Tracy station to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station. However, there are services departing from Lathrop/Manteca Station and arriving at Sunnyvale Caltrain Northbound via Santa Clara Caltrain Northbound.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 20m.
The distance between Tracy and Sunnyvale Caltrain Station is 88 miles. The road distance is 51.9 miles.
The best way to get from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station without a car is to train which takes 2h 20m and costs $45 - $60.
It takes approximately 2h 20m to get from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station, including transfers.
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station train services, operated by Altamont Corridor Express, depart from Lathrop/Manteca Station.
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station train services, operated by Altamont Corridor Express, arrive at Santa Clara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station is 52 miles. It takes approximately 1h 3m to drive from Tracy to Sunnyvale Caltrain Station.

What companies run services between Tracy, CA, USA and Sunnyvale Caltrain Station, CA, USA?
Altamont Corridor Express operates a train from Lathrop/Manteca Station to Santa Clara Station 3 times a day. Tickets cost $12–16 and the journey takes 1h 41m.
